The Impact of Stockouts on Building Materials Distributors
Stockouts not only delay customer orders but can also damage your business reputation and disrupt construction projects reliant on timely material delivery. Common causes of stockouts include inaccurate inventory records, unpredictable demand spikes, and supplier delays.
Effective inventory management systems must detect low stock levels promptly and notify purchasing or warehouse teams to replenish critical items quickly.
How Real-Time Inventory Alerts Work
Real-time inventory alerts leverage continuous data monitoring and smart threshold settings to trigger notifications instantly when stock reaches critical levels. These alerts can be delivered via email, SMS, or ERP dashboard notifications, enabling immediate action.
Buildix ERP’s real-time alert functionality integrates with your warehouse management and procurement systems to provide:
Instant Low Stock Warnings: Alerts trigger once stock dips below pre-defined reorder points set by SKU or category.
Expiration and Shelf-Life Notifications: For perishable or time-sensitive building materials, alerts flag approaching expiry dates.
Supplier Lead Time Delays: The system flags if expected deliveries are late, allowing contingency planning.
Demand Surge Detection: Alerts can identify unusual sales spikes that might threaten inventory availability.

Best Practices for Implementing Real-Time Inventory Alerts
Set Accurate Reorder Points: Use Buildix ERP’s analytics to calculate optimal reorder points per SKU based on historical demand and supplier lead times.
Prioritize Critical Categories: Customize alerts to focus on high-impact products essential for customer projects.
Integrate Alerts with Mobile WMS: Equip warehouse teams with mobile access to alerts and inventory updates for quick response.
Regularly Review and Adjust Thresholds: Market conditions and demand patterns change — keep your alert thresholds updated accordingly.
Train Staff on Alert Response Protocols: Ensure procurement and warehouse teams understand how to act on alerts swiftly and effectively.
